#ce31d7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ce31d7 is composed of 80.8% red, 19.2%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.2%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 296.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 51.8%. #ce31d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#9d00af.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#ce31d7 color description : Strong magenta.
The hexadecimal color #ce31d7 has RGB values of R:206, G:49,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13513175.
